LCOV - code coverage report
Current view: top level - core/core/string - SPGost3411-2012.cc (source / functions) Hit Total Coverage
Test: coverage.info Lines: 136 139 97.8 %
Date: 2024-05-12 00:16:13 Functions: 27 27 100.0 %

Function Name Sort by function name Hit count Sort by hit count
stappler::crypto::Gost3411_256::make(stappler::CoderSource const&, stappler::StringViewBase<char> const&) 25
stappler::crypto::Gost3411_512::make(stappler::CoderSource const&, stappler::StringViewBase<char> const&) 25
stappler::crypto::Gost3411_256::final() 175
stappler::crypto::Gost3411_256::hmac(stappler::CoderSource const&, stappler::CoderSource const&) 400
stappler::crypto::Gost3411_512::hmac(stappler::CoderSource const&, stappler::CoderSource const&) 450
stappler::crypto::Gost3411_512::final() 500
stappler::crypto::Gost3411_256::Gost3411_256() 575
stappler::crypto::Gost3411_256::init() 800
stappler::crypto::Gost3411_512::init() 900
stappler::crypto::Gost3411_512::final(unsigned char*) 900
stappler::crypto::Gost3411_512::Gost3411_512() 950
stappler::crypto::Gost3411_256::final(unsigned char*) 1050
stappler::crypto::Gost3411_256::update(unsigned char const*, unsigned long) 2050
stappler::crypto::Gost3411_256::update(stappler::CoderSource const&) 2050
stappler::crypto::(anonymous namespace)::gost3411_hash_finish(stappler::crypto::Gost3411_Ctx*, unsigned char*) 2625
stappler::crypto::(anonymous namespace)::pad(stappler::crypto::Gost3411_Ctx*) 2625
stappler::crypto::(anonymous namespace)::stage3(stappler::crypto::Gost3411_Ctx*) 2625
stappler::crypto::Gost3411_512::update(unsigned char const*, unsigned long) 2900
stappler::crypto::Gost3411_512::update(stappler::CoderSource const&) 2900
stappler::crypto::(anonymous namespace)::gost3411_hash_init(stappler::crypto::Gost3411_Ctx*, unsigned int) 3225
stappler::crypto::(anonymous namespace)::gost3411_hash_update(stappler::crypto::Gost3411_Ctx*, unsigned char const*, unsigned long) 4900
stappler::crypto::(anonymous namespace)::stage2(stappler::crypto::Gost3411_Ctx*, stappler::crypto::uint512_u const*) 6600
stappler::crypto::_buffer512() 6600
stappler::crypto::(anonymous namespace)::g(stappler::crypto::uint512_u*, stappler::crypto::uint512_u const*, stappler::crypto::uint512_u const*) 14475
stappler::crypto::(anonymous namespace)::add512(stappler::crypto::uint512_u*, stappler::crypto::uint512_u const*) 18450
stappler::crypto::_C(int) 173700
stappler::crypto::_Ax(int, int) 23160000

Generated by: LCOV version 1.14